ABSTRACT:
A control joint for forming and controlling concrete structures such as floors and tilt-up walls. The joint has a base and an upstanding web and is preferably extruded from plastic having a honeycomb cell structure. The honeycomb structure may include a metal reinforcing section extending within the structure along the length of the joint. The joint may be utilized to form various concrete structures such as sidewalks, pads and tilt-up walls.
